Marianne Streifler (born 5 February 1951) is a former pair skater who represented West Germany. With Herbert Wiesinger, she is the 1967 Prague Skate silver medalist and a three-time West German national medalist. The pair placed 11th at the 1968 Winter Olympics in Grenoble and 6th at the 1969 European Championships in Garmisch-Partenkirchen.
During her competitive career, Streifler was a member of FREC in Frankfurt am Main.[1] After retiring from competition, she spent four years skating for Holiday on Ice.[2] She then coached in Lauterbach, Hesse before relocating in 2008 to Füssen, Bavaria.[3][4]
